6.2.8

Setting range correction

The values of the background peak/text peak in the range correction at the Black Mode can be
switched to "varied" or "fixed" in the following codes.
If they are fixed, the range correction is performed with standard values.
The values of the background peak affects the reproduction of the background density, and the values
of the text peak affects that of the text density.

6.2.9
Adjustment of smudged/faint text
The smudge/faint text at a Black Mode can be set at the following codes.

Remarks
When the value decreases, the
faint text is improved. When the
value increases, the smudged text
is improved.
Acceptable values: 0 to 4
(Default: 2)
